1CdS/Cu纳米光催化剂降解废水中的HMX和RDX试验研究(英文)显示文摘The wastewater with HMX and RDX was treated by photodegradation process in the presence of cadmium sulfide doped with copper as photocatalyst under UV and Vis irradiations.The influence on the degration of Cu% as dopant in CdS/Cu nanoparticles,pH of solution,dosage of photocatalyst and concentration of explosives were studied.The XRD patterns and UV-Vis spectra were used to characterize the nanoparticle.Results show that the degradation efficiency for HMX and RDX wastewater reaches 85%-88% in the presence of Cd0.95Cu0.05S under 180 min UV irradiation.The dosage of 160.0 mg·L-1 of photocatalyst and the pH of 7 are the optimum.A gradual decrease in degradation at the first two cycles is seen.Hamid Reza Pouretedal Mohammad Hossien Keshavarz Mohammad Hasan Yosefi Arash Shokrollahi Abbas Zali 2008含能材料2008,16,6:5
2Keto-RDX的合成及性能计算(英文)显示文摘Keto-RDX was obtained by one-step method with a certain amount of RDX as by-product.The effects of various parameters on high yield were studied.A simple analytical method was also introduced to determine simultaneously Keto-RDX/RDX mole ratio.Some important theoretical characterizations of Keto-RDX such as detonation performance at maximum nominal density and shock sensitivity were determined by new methods and compared with RDX.Arash Shokrollahi Abbas Zali Hamid Reza Pouretedal Mohammad Hossein Keshavarz 2008含能材料2008,16,1:4
3Optimized polymer flooding projects via combination of experimental design and reservoir simulation显示文摘The conventional approach for an EOR process is to compare the reservoir properties with those of successful worldwide projects.However,some proper cases may be neglected due to the lack of reliable data.A combination of experimental design and reservoir simulation is an alternative approach.In this work,the fractional factorial design suggests some numerical experiments which their results are analyzed by statistical inference.After determination of the main effects and interactions,the most important parameters of polymer flooding are studied by ANOVA method and Pareto and Tornado charts.Analysis of main effects shows that the oil viscosity,connate water saturation and the horizontal permeability are the 3 deciding factors in oil production.The proposed methodology can help to select the good candidate reservoirs for polymer flooding.Ali Bengar Siyamak Moradi Mostafa Ganjeh-Ghazvini Amin Shokrollahi 2017Petroleum2017,3,4:2
